French fancy
French Fashion label Comptoir des Cotonniers held its first ever London casting auditions this month at its Westbourne Grove store. The search was on for real mother-and-daughter couples to appear in Comptoir’s fashion shows and advertising campaigns for the autumn/winter collections. The turnout filled the boutique with glamorous mummies and their angelic Mini-Mes. Applicants came from far and wide, with one pair travelling up from Dorset for the event. While the children played among the clothes rails, the mothers enjoyed Nicolas Feuillette champagne and indulged in some retail therapy between the all-important photocalls with photographer Melvyn Vincent.

On the up
Elegantly refurbished with breathtakingly high ceilings with ornate roses and huge sash windows, Upstairs at The Oak has reopened above the gastropub on Westbourne Park Road. Local residents and business owners gathered at a series of parties to celebrate its return. And with Lily Cole seen dining downstairs, The Oak looks set for a fantastic comeback.

Mad Hatters
Guests arrived in crazy hats, animal ears, masks and horns as Notting Hill’s most glamorous hostess, Tamsin Lonsdale, held an exclusive party for members of The Supper Club. The Mad Hatter’s Easter Bash, which was held at Number 5 Cavendish Square, W1, was attended by 200 members who enjoyed a selection of U'Luvka Vodka cocktails, ate the Mad Hatter’s cake and danced to music by DJ Jimmy V.
